The newer (SFD) modules may have different Adaptation/Long Coding entries so a bit of searching might be required (VAG tend to keep the syntax mostly the same).@t_v I assume that just because OBD11 is compatible with SFD, it doesn't automatically mean that it can overcome locked down functions? I'm trying to add TSR, but the necessary modules don't seem to be there.
But not this one:Control unit 5F (Information Control Unit)
Adaptation
Name: Car_Function_List_BAP_Gen2
Access Control: traffic_sign_recognition_0x21
Value = activated
I've achieved something, as the car now thinks it's got TSR, but it's throwing a TSR error on the dash all the time.Name: Car_Function_Adaptations_Gen2
Access Control: menu_display_road_sign_identification
Value = activated
